A pulse damper is actually a chamber filled with an easily compressed fluid and a versatile diaphragm. Over the piston’s ahead stroke the fluid in the pulse damper is compressed. When the piston withdraws to refill the pump, tension through the increasing fluid in the heartbeat damper maintains the movement fee.

前述した従来の順相タイプに対して、逆相クロマトグラフィーにおいては固定相に低極性のもの(例えばシリカゲルにアルキル基を共有結合させたもの)を、移動相に高極性のもの(例えば水や塩類の水溶液、アルコール、アセトニトリルなどの有機溶媒)を用いる。また珍しいケースではあるが、分離のための移動相pHをシリカゲルの使用範囲から外れたところに設定する必要がある場合、あるいはシリカゲル表面に残っている未反応シラノール基が分離に悪影響を及ぼし、かつそれが移動相の変更によっても解決できない場合には、固定相として樹脂を用いることがある。分析物はより極性の低いほどより強く固定相と相互作用して溶出が遅くなる。また極性の低い物質の割合が多い移動相ほど溶出が早くなる。

加温することが多かったため「オーブン、ヒーター」と称されるが、現在では周辺気温より低温にするための冷却機能が付いている装置も多い。また、周辺気温付近で使用する場合にも冷却機能は一定の効果がある。

Compounds in the sample partition involving the stationary stage and also the cell stage in partition chromatography. Compounds which has a more robust affinity with the stationary stage expend far more time interacting with it, resulting in slower elution from your column.

The elution purchase of solutes in HPLC is ruled by polarity. For a standard-period separation, a solute of decrease polarity spends proportionally considerably less time inside the polar stationary phase and elutes right before a solute that is certainly much more polar. Given a selected stationary period, retention moments in normal-section HPLC are controlled by changing the mobile period’s Houses. One example is, if the resolution involving two solutes is lousy, switching to the a lot less polar cellular stage keeps the solutes about the column for a longer time and provides far more prospect for his or her separation.
